Summary of the invention
The technical problem to be solved is to provide the bolt that a kind of anti-derotation comes off, and by arranging locking member, uses
In solving to be susceptible under the conditions of existing bolt is in long-term vibration the technical problem of derotation and loose or dislocation.
In order to realize solving the purpose of above-mentioned technical problem, present invention employs following technical scheme:
The bolt that a kind of anti-derotation of the present invention comes off, for preventing the bolt as fixing connector being in long-term vibration bar
Reversely rotate loose or dislocation under part, it is characterized in that: include bolt and locking member;
Described bolt includes screwing head, screw rod and nut;Screw rod is vertically set on and screws below head, and its side is provided with locking slot;
Described nut side is provided with at least one locking hole;Nut downside is provided with blind hole, is provided with locking pin in this blind hole;Lock
Tight pin is connected by flexible member with between nut, enables locking pin to stretch out or retraction blind hole;
Described locking member is U-shaped part, and the upper end of this U-shaped part is pin interpolating unit, and lower end is tight lock part, and tight lock part rear end is locking area,
Locking area is provided with the through hole corresponding with locking pin;
Described nut sleeve is on screw rod, and the pin interpolating unit of U-shaped part is inserted in the locking hole of nut side, and the tight lock part of U-shaped part inserts
In the locking slot of screw rod side, the locking pin on nut inserts in the through hole on U-shaped part locking area.
Concrete: described in screw head be outer six sides, interior six sides, outer four directions or interior tetragonal.
Concrete: described nut is provided with alignment mark.This makes the locking hole on nut and spiral shell when being for the ease of using
Locking slot alignment on bar.
Concrete: described locking pin lower end is hemispherical dome structure.When this is for the ease of using this shockproof self-locking screw, peace
Dress locking member.
Concrete: described bolt also includes cushion, and this cushion is arranged on above nut.This is to enable fine adjustment spiral shell
Female rotation, it is simple to the locking hole on nut is corresponding with the locking slot on screw rod.
Concrete: described nut is arranged over elastic layer.
Concrete: the bolt that described anti-derotation comes off also includes mounting blocks, and this mounting blocks is a cylinder being provided with expansion-head
Section, the length of this cylindrical section is equal to the thickness of locking area on U-shaped part.When installing nut, rotate fastening nut and make on nut
Locking hole corresponding with the locking slot on screw rod;Then this mounting blocks is inserted from below in the through hole on U-shaped part locking area,
Then the through hole on U-shaped part locking area is just blocked by the cylindrical section of mounting blocks;Then the pin interpolating unit of U-shaped part is inserted nut side
Locking hole in, the tight lock part of U-shaped part inserts in the locking slot of screw rod side;Then extract mounting blocks out, then locking pin falls into U-shaped
In through hole on part locking area;Owing to the pin interpolating unit of U-shaped part is stuck on nut, tight lock part is stuck in the locking slot of screw rod side,
Then nut is under long-term vibration environment, also can not occur to reversely rotate and loose or dislocation from screw rod.
The most concrete: the material of described mounting blocks is rubber.Utilize the elasticity of quality of rubber materials, beneficially mounting blocks with
The tight fit of U-shaped part, prevents its landing when mounted.

Detailed description of the invention
With embodiment, this patent is further explained below in conjunction with the accompanying drawings.But the protection domain of this patent is not limited to tool
The embodiment of body.
Embodiment 1
As shown in drawings, the bolt that a kind of anti-derotation of this patent comes off, for preventing the bolt as fixing connector at place
Under the conditions of long-term vibration, reversely rotate loose or dislocation, it is characterized in that: include bolt 1 and locking member 2.
Bolt 1 includes screwing 3, screw rod 4 and a nut 5;Screw rod 4 is vertically set on and screws below 3, and its side is provided with lock
Tight groove 6.
Nut 5 side is provided with at least one locking hole 7;Nut 5 downside is provided with blind hole 8, is provided with locking in this blind hole 8
Pin 9;It is connected by flexible member 10 between locking pin 9 with nut 5, makes locking pin 9 to stretch out or retraction blind hole 8.
Locking member 2 is U-shaped part, and the upper end of this U-shaped part is pin interpolating unit 11, and lower end is tight lock part 12, and tight lock part 12 rear end is
Locking area 13, locking area 13 is provided with the through hole 14 corresponding with locking pin 9.
Nut 5 is enclosed within screw rod 4, and the pin interpolating unit 11 of U-shaped part is inserted in the locking hole 7 of nut 5 side, the locking of U-shaped part
Portion 12 inserts in the locking slot 6 of screw rod 4 side, and the locking pin 9 on nut 5 inserts in the through hole 14 on U-shaped part locking area 13.
Wherein, 3 are screwed for outer hexagonal structure;Nut 5 is provided with alignment mark, and this makes nut when being for the ease of using
Locking hole 7 on 5 is directed at the locking slot 6 on screw rod 4;Locking pin 9 lower end is hemispherical dome structure, and this is to be somebody's turn to do for the ease of using
During shockproof self-locking screw, locking member 2 is installed.
Bolt 1 also includes cushion, and this cushion is arranged on above nut 5, and this is to rotate to enable fine adjustment nut 5,
The locking hole 7 being easy on nut 5 is corresponding with the locking slot 6 on screw rod 4.
The bolt that this anti-derotation comes off also includes mounting blocks, and this mounting blocks is a cylindrical section being provided with expansion-head, this cylinder
The length of section is equal to the thickness of locking area 13 on U-shaped part;When installing nut 5, rotate fastening nut 5 and make the lock on nut 5
Tieholen 7 is corresponding with the locking slot 6 on screw rod 4;Then this mounting blocks is inserted from below the through hole 14 on U-shaped part locking area 13
In, then the through hole 14 on U-shaped part locking area 13 is just blocked by the cylindrical section of mounting blocks;Then the pin interpolating unit 11 of U-shaped part is inserted
Entering in the locking hole 7 of nut 5 side, the tight lock part 12 of U-shaped part inserts in the locking slot 6 of screw rod 4 side;Then installation is extracted out
Block, then in locking pin 9 falls into the through hole 14 on U-shaped part locking area 13;Owing to the pin interpolating unit 11 of U-shaped part is stuck on nut 5, locking
Portion 12 is stuck in the locking slot 6 of screw rod 4 side, then nut 5 is under long-term vibration environment, also can not occur from screw rod 4 reversely
Rotate and loose or dislocation.
The material of mounting blocks is rubber, utilizes the tight fit of the elasticity of quality of rubber materials, beneficially mounting blocks and U-shaped part, anti-
Only its landing when mounted.
